Job Description:
We are seeking an experienced and passionate Procurement Specialist to join our EMEA Procurement team. In this role, you will focus on indirect procurement categories with a strong emphasis on project management, contracting, and analytics. Working closely with key stakeholders across various business units, you will play a crucial role in driving cost reduction strategies and implementing effective procurement plans.
Job Responsibility:
  • Support supplier selection, tendering, negotiations, and supplier consolidation efforts
  • Implement critical contracts and manage supplier performance
  • Identify cost-saving opportunities through strategic spend analysis and market evaluation
  • Improve procurement processes and provide insightful reports to management and stakeholders
  • Issue Requests for Quotations (RFQ) and coordinate competitive bidding to secure the best value for goods and services
  • Support negotiations on payment terms
  • Oversee purchase order processes and invoicing within company systems in line with policies
  • Collaborate with Global and Regional Category Managers to execute global and regional procurement strategies
  • Engage with internal stakeholders to understand procurement needs and review supplier tenders
  • Promote best practices and drive continuous improvement initiatives across the EMEA region
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ree required
  • Master's degree preferred
  • 2-5 years of relevant experience in procurement with a strong focus on cost savings
  • Experience in project management and influencing within a matrix organization
  • Previous experience in the healthcare sector is advantageous
  • Strong negotiation skills with experience managing national and international suppliers
  • Fluent in English (written and spoken)
  • additional European language skills are an advantage
  • Proficient in MS Office and ERP systems
  • Strong analytical skills with a solid understanding of financial fundamentals and business control policies
  • Proactive, open-minded, and enthusiastic with a passion for procurement
